NTFS vs. ReFS-hogyan lehet eldönteni, hogy melyiket használja

mostanra valószínűleg hallott a Microsoft viszonylag friss “ReFS”fájlrendszeréről. A Windows Server 2012-vel bevezetett rendszer stabilitása és méretezhetősége tekintetében igyekszik meghaladni az NTFS-t. Mivel a VHDX-eket általában több virtuális géphez tároljuk ugyanabban a kötetben, úgy tűnik, hogy jól párosul A ReFS-szel. Sajnos nem … az elején. A Microsoft a közbeeső években tovább javította A ReFS-t. Számos olyan funkciót szerzett, amelyek elhatárolták az NTFS-től. Érésével el kell kezdenie használni a Hyper-V-hez? Sok mindent meg kell fontolnod, mielőtt eldöntöd.

mi az A ReFS?

A “ReFS” becenév “rugalmas fájlrendszert”jelent. Ez magában foglalja a beépített funkciók, hogy segítse az adatok korrupció. A Microsoft docs webhelye részletes magyarázatot nyújt A ReFS-ről és annak jellemzőiről. Rövid összefoglaló:

  • Integritásfolyamok: A ReFS ellenőrző összegeket használ a fájl sérülésének ellenőrzésére.
  • Automatikus javítás: amikor A ReFS problémákat észlel egy fájlban, automatikusan végrehajtja a korrekciós intézkedéseket.
  • teljesítményjavítások: néhány speciális körülmények között A ReFS teljesítményelőnyöket nyújt az NTFS-hez képest.
  • nagyon nagy volumenű és fájltámogatás: A ReFS felső határai meghaladják az NTFS-t anélkül, hogy azonos teljesítményütéseket okoznának.
  • tükör-gyorsított paritás: a tükör-gyorsított paritás sok nyers tárhelyet használ, de nagyon gyors és nagyon rugalmas.
  • integráció tárolóhelyekkel: A ReFS számos funkciója csak a tárolóhelyekkel együtt működik teljes mértékben.

mielőtt izgatottá válna néhány korábbi pont miatt, egy dolgot ki kell emelnem: a kapacitáskorlátok kivételével A ReFS tárolóhelyeket igényel a legjobb munka elvégzéséhez.

ReFS a Hyper-V előnyei

A ReFS olyan funkciókkal rendelkezik, amelyek felgyorsítják a virtuális gép egyes tevékenységeit.

  • Blokkklónozás: olvasásom szerint a blokkklónozás lényegében a duplikáció megszüntetésének egyik formája. De nem működik fájlrendszer-szűrőként vagy szkennerként. Nem passzív módon várja meg az önkényes adatok írását, vagy rendszeresen ellenőrzi a fájlrendszert másolatok után. Valaminek aktívan fel kell hívnia egy adott fájl ellen. A Microsoft kifejezetten jelzi, hogy nagyban felgyorsíthatja az ellenőrzőpontok összeolvadását.
  • ritka VDL (érvényes adathossz): minden fájlrendszer rögzíti a fájlhoz rendelt terület mennyiségét. A ReFS a VDL használatával jelzi, hogy a fájl mennyi adatot tartalmaz. Tehát, ha utasítja a Hyper-V-t, hogy hozzon létre egy új rögzített VHDX-et A ReFS-en, akkor a teljes fájlt körülbelül ugyanannyi idő alatt hozhatja létre, mint egy dinamikusan bővülő VHDX létrehozását. Hasonlóképpen előnyös lesz a dinamikusan bővülő VHDX-ek bővítési műveletei.

Vegyünk egy kis időt, hogy menjen át ezeket a funkciókat. Gondolja át a teljes alkalmazást.

ReFS vs.NTFS a Hyper-V-hez: technikai összehasonlítás

az Általános magyarázattal az útból, most jobban értékelheti a különbségeket. Először ellenőrizze az összehasonlító táblázatokat a Microsoft ReFS áttekintő oldalán. A tipikus Hyper-V telepítéseknél a legtöbb különbség nagyon keveset jelent. Például valószínűleg nincs szüksége kvótákra a Hyper-V tárolóhelyein. Készítsünk egy saját táblázatot, amely jobban megfelel a Hyper-V-nek:

  • ReFS-győzelmek: nagyon nagy tárhelyek és nagyon nagy VHDX-ek
  • ReFS-győzelmek: olyan környezetek, ahol a létrehozott, ellenőrzött vagy egyesített VHDX-ek rendkívül nagy gyakorisággal fordulnak elő
  • ReFS-győzelmek: tárhely és tárolóhelyek közvetlen telepítések
  • NTFS-győzelmek: egykötetes telepítések
  • NTFS nyer (potenciálisan): vegyes célú telepítések

azt hiszem, ezek a dolgok magukért beszélnek. Az utolsó kettőnek valószínűleg egy kicsit több magyarázatra van szüksége.

az egykötetes telepítésekhez NTFS

szükséges ebben az összefüggésben az “egykötetes telepítés” olyan telepítéseket jelent, ahol a Hyper-V (beleértve a felügyeleti operációs rendszert is) és az összes virtuális gép ugyanazon a köteten van. A rendszerindító kötetet nem formázhatja ReFS-sel, sem oldalfájlt nem helyezhet el A ReFS-re. Egy ilyen telepítés szintén nem teszi lehetővé a tárolóhelyeket vagy a tárolóhelyeket közvetlenül, így egyébként kihagyná A ReFS legtöbb képességét.

a vegyes célú telepítésekhez szükség lehet NTFS-re

néhányunknak szerencséje van, hogy csak virtuális gépeket telepítsen dedikált tárhelyekre. Nem mindenkinek van ilyen. Ha a Hyper-V tárterület más célokra is tárol fájlokat, előfordulhat, hogy folytatnia kell az NTFS-t. Menjen át az utolsó táblázaton az Áttekintő oldal alján. Megmutatja azokat a tulajdonságokat, amelyeket csak az NTFS-ben találhat meg. A szokásos fájlmegosztási forgatókönyvek esetén elveszíti a kvótákat. Lehet, hogy olyan régi alkalmazásai vannak, amelyek NTFS kiterjesztett tulajdonságait vagy rövid nevét igénylik. Ezekben a helyzetekben csak az NTFS fog működni.

Megjegyzés: Ha van más lehetősége, ne használja ugyanazt a gazdagépet nem Hyper-V szerepkörök futtatásához a Hyper-V mellett. Hasonlóképpen különítse el a Hyper-V virtuális gépeket a kötetekre, kivéve a más fájltípusokat tartalmazó köteteket.

váratlan ReFS viselkedés

a hivatalos tartalom bizonyos mértékig leírja A ReFS integritási adatfolyamainak előnyeit. Ellenőrző összegeket használ a fájlkorrupció észlelésére. Ha problémákat talál, korrekciós intézkedéseket hajt végre. A védelmi sémákat használó tárolóhelyek kötetén lehetősége van a probléma megoldására. Ezt teszi az online hangerővel, zökkenőmentes élményt nyújtva. De mi történik, ha A ReFS nem tudja kijavítani a problémát? Ez az, ahol valódi figyelmet kell fordítania.

az áttekintő oldalon a dokumentáció kivételesen homályos megfogalmazást használ: “A ReFS eltávolítja a sérült adatokat a névtérből”. Az integrity streams oldal rosszabb: “ha a kísérlet sikertelen, A ReFS hibát ad vissza.”A cikk kutatása közben egy aggasztóbb tevékenységről meséltek nekem: A ReFS törli azokat a fájlokat, amelyeket javíthatatlannak tart. Az oldal alján található megjegyzés szakasz megerősítő jelentést tartalmaz. Ha végigköveti ezt a megjegyzésszálat, talál egy bejegyzést a Microsoft programkezelőjétől, amely kimondja:

A ReFS két esetben törli a fájlokat:

  1. A ReFS észleli a metaadatok sérülését, és nincs mód a javításra. Jelentése ReFS nem egy tárolóhely redundáns kötet, ahol meg tudja javítani a sérült példányt.
  2. A ReFS adatsérülést észlel, és az Integritásfolyam engedélyezve van, és nincs mód a javításra. Ez azt jelenti, hogy ha az Integrity Stream nincs engedélyezve, akkor a fájl elérhető lesz, függetlenül attól, hogy az adatok sérültek-e vagy sem. Ha A ReFS tükrözött köteten fut tárolóhelyeket használva, a sérült másolat automatikusan javításra kerül.

az eredmény: ha A ReFS úgy dönt, hogy a VHDX helyrehozhatatlan károkat szenvedett, törli azt. Nem fog kérni, és nem ad lehetőséget arra, hogy megpróbálja megmenteni, amit tudsz. Ha A ReFS-t nem támogatja a Tárolóhelyek redundanciája, akkor nincs módja a javítás elvégzésére. Így, egy szempontból, ami ReFS nem tároló terek néz ki, mint egy nagyon magas kockázatú megközelítés. De …

Vigyázzon A Biztonsági Mentésekre!

nem szabad figyelmen kívül hagyni az előző szakasz súlyosságát. Azonban ne hagyja, hogy megijeszteni el, bármelyik. Természetesen megértem, hogy inkább egy részben olvasható VHDX-et szeretne törölni. Ebből a célból egyszerűen letilthatja az integritásfolyamokat a virtuális gépek fájljain. Van egy másik javaslatom is.

ne hagyja figyelmen kívül a biztonsági mentéseket! Ha A ReFS töröl egy fájlt, töltse le a biztonsági mentésből. Ha EGY VHDX megsérül az NTFS-en, töltse le a biztonsági mentésből. A ReFS, legalább tudod, hogy van egy probléma. Az NTFS segítségével a problémák sokkal hosszabb ideig rejtőzhetnek. Nem számít a konfiguráció, az egyetlen dolog, amire támaszkodhat az adatok védelme érdekében, egy szilárd biztonsági mentési megoldás.

mikor válassza NTFS Hyper-V

most már elég információt, hogy tájékozott döntést. Ezek a feltételek jó állapotot jeleznek az NTFS számára:

  • olyan konfigurációk, amelyek nem használnak tárhelyet, például egylemezes vagy gyártói RAID. Ez önmagában nem tesz légmentesen pontot; kérjük, olvassa el a ” Ne feledje a biztonsági mentéseket!”a fenti szakasz.
  • egykötetes rendszerek (a gazdagépnek csak C: kötete van)
  • vegyes célú rendszerek (kérjük, állítson be külön szerepköröket)
  • tárolás a 2016-nál régebbi gazdagépeken-A ReFS nem volt olyan érett a korábbi verziókban. Ez önmagában nem légmentes pont.
  • a biztonsági mentési alkalmazás gyártója nem támogatja A ReFS
  • ha bizonytalan A ReFS

az idő múlásával az NTFS elveszíti A ReFS előnyben részesítését a Hyper-V telepítésekben. De ez nem azt jelenti, hogy az NTFS elérte a végét. A ReFS megdöbbentően magasabb korlátokkal rendelkezik, de nagyon kevés rendszer használ többet, mint egy töredéke annak, amit az NTFS kínál. A ReFS lenyűgöző rugalmassági funkciókkal rendelkezik, de az NTFS öngyógyító képességekkel is rendelkezik, és hozzáférhet a raid technológiákhoz az adatkorrupció elleni védekezéshez.

a Microsoft folytatja A ReFS fejlesztését. Végül az NTFS utódjaként helyezhetik el. A mai napig nem tették meg. Úgy néz ki, hogy holnap sem fogják megcsinálni. Ne érezzen nyomást arra, hogy a kényelmi szint előtt mozogjon A ReFS-re.

mikor kell kiválasztani A ReFS-t a Hyper-V – hez

egyes helyzetekben A ReFS egyértelmű választás a Hyper-V adatok tárolására:

  • Storage Spaces (és Storage Spaces Direct) környezetek
  • Extremely large volumes
  • Extremely large VHDXs

előfordulhat, hogy egy további teljesítmény-alapú argumentumot hoz létre A ReFS számára olyan környezetben, ahol nagyon nagy a VHDX fájlok lemorzsolódása. Azonban ne becsülje túl a teljesítményjavítások hatását. A legszembetűnőbb különbség akkor jelenik meg, amikor rögzített VHDX-eket hoz létre. Minden más művelethez frissítenie kell a hardvert, hogy jelentős javulást érjen el.

azonban nem akarom elkendőzni javára ReFS nagyon nagy mennyiségben. Ha a tárhely mennyisége néhány terabájt, a VHDXs pedig akár néhány száz gigabájt, akkor A ReFS ritkán fogja jelentősen legyőzni az NTFS-t. Amikor több száz terabájtra kezd gondolkodni, az NTFS valószínűleg szűk keresztmetszeteket mutat. Ha magasabbra kell nyomni, akkor A ReFS lesz az egyetlen választás.

A ReFS valóban ragyog, ha közvetlenül a tárolóhelyekkel kombinálja. Valóban lenyűgöző az a képessége, hogy automatikusan elvégezzen egy nem zavaró online javítást. Egyrészt a modern rendszerek zavaró adatkorrupciójának esélye statisztikai anomáliát jelent. Másrészt senkit, aki szenvedett egy ilyen esemény miatt, nem igazán érdekel, mennyire valószínűtlen volt.

ReFS vs NTFS a Hyper-V vendég fájlrendszereken

a fentiek mindegyike csak a Hyper-V virtuális gépek tárolásával foglalkozik. Mi a helyzet a vendég operációs rendszerek ReFS-jével?

a kérdés megválaszolásához vissza kell térnünk A ReFS erősségeihez. Eddig csak a Hyper-v-re gondoltunk. a vendégeknek megvannak a saját feltételeik és igényeik. Kezdjük a Microsoft ReFS áttekintésével. Konkrétan a következő:

“a Microsoft kifejezetten általános célú használatra fejlesztette ki az NTFS-t konfigurációk és munkaterhelések széles skálájával, azonban azoknak az ügyfeleknek, akik kifejezetten igénylik A ReFS által biztosított rendelkezésre állást, rugalmasságot és/vagy skálát, a Microsoft támogatja A ReFS használatát az alábbi konfigurációk és forgatókönyvek szerint…”

kiemeltem azt a részt, amelyet szeretném, ha figyelembe vennél. Maga a mondat arra készteti Önt, hogy tovább fognak sorolni néhány felhasználást, de csak egyet sorolnak fel: “biztonsági mentési cél”. A listán szereplő többi elem csak a tárolási konfigurációról beszél. Tehát vissza kell ásnunk a mondatba, és ki kell húznunk azt a három leírást, amelyek segítenek eldönteni: “elérhetőség”, “rugalmasság” és “skála”. Az első kettőt azonnal eldobhatja — nem szabad a virtuális gépen belüli tárhely elérhetőségére és rugalmasságára összpontosítania. Ez “skálát”hagy nekünk. Tehát nagyon nagy kötetek és nagyon nagy fájlok. Ne feledje, hogy ez több száz terabájtot jelent.

a pontosabb döntés érdekében olvassa el a szolgáltatás-összehasonlításokat. Ha egy vendégen belül használni kívánt alkalmazásnak csak az NTFS-en található funkciókra van szüksége, használja az NTFS-t. Személy szerint még mindig szinte kizárólag az NTFS-t használom a vendégeken belül. A ReFS-nek tárolóhelyekre van szüksége a legjobb munka elvégzéséhez, a Tárolóhelyek pedig a fizikai rétegben végzik a legjobb munkát.

ReFS és NTFS kombinálása Hyper-V gazdagépeken és vendégeken

ne feledje, hogy a vendégen belüli fájlrendszer nincs hatással a gazdagép fájlrendszerére, és fordítva. Amennyire a Hyper-V tudja, a virtuális gépekhez csatlakoztatott VHDX-ek nem más, mint egy adatblokk-csomag. Használhat bármilyen kombinációt, amely működik.



+